Chapter 124 - THE CALL

*Audra's POV*

It took a moment for my mind to stitch itself together.

The dark was heavy, pressing against my eyes, the kind that made time blur and bend. For a second, I couldn't tell if it was night or just the absence of light. The air was still, except for the quiet creak of the walls, the soft, distant thump of something settling outside. 

I didn't remember falling asleep.

The wood beneath me was hard and unforgiving, the edges of the chair digging into my skin. My wrists brushed against the rough surface where I'd scraped faint marks earlier—small, almost invisible, but mine. The ropes had loosened just enough to let me shift slightly, not enough to matter.

The blanket tangled at my ankles was damp with the warmth of my own body, my knees stiff from being held in the same position for too long. I pressed my chin against my chest, half-expecting to feel the frantic thud of my pulse leaping against my ribs.

It was there. Loud. Sharp. Too fast.
